Back to All Jobs in 25 mile radius of Windsor, MO
JBS
25 mile radius of Windsor, MO
yesterday
Windsor, MO, US
FIELD MANAGER - Northwest Missouri
My Saved Jobs
Location
Windsor, Missouri, USA
(1)
Distance
Job Search
Windsor, MO Jobs
Apply Later